1 - I had a email from hotmail and I never had problems to access my wallet.

2 - My email from hotmail was blocked and I created a new email from ProtonMail

3 - I made a request to change my wallet email.

4 - Blockchain send me a email (this email was send to my new email from protonmail) to confirm and aprove the new wallet email.

5 - Confirmed. My address from protonmail is my current wallet email.

6 - When a tried to login in my blockchain wallet they asked me to check my email to approve my login attempt (as usual). But this emails never arrive in my email. I also searched in span and trash, still nothing. It's been over 24 hours. What can I do? Have I lost my money? Please guys, help with this problem.

Did you create a backup of your wallet?

If you created a backup of your wallet, then you did not lose your money.

If you did not create a backup of your wallet, then why not?  That is the most important and very first thing you should do before you ever send any money to the wallet!

If you do not have a backup of your wallet, you will need to contact blockchain.info support. They control your account and they are the only people that can help you.

Sometimes there can be a big delay in when you enter the password in blockchain.info and when you actually receive the email for you to approve the login attempt. Just try again, and see what happens.

If it still doesn't work then use your 12 word recovery phrase to recover your wallet. You should have received this when you signed up, and it isn't really a "backup".

If you don't have that, then you'll have to contact support. May be something wrong with their email service provider.
